We are hiring a field-oriented business-development professional to expand the firm's referral network, community presence and strategic relationships throughout Central and Southern California. This person will create new relationships, make high-quality introductions to the CEO, represent the firm at legal and community events and help convert approved opportunities into accepted signed matters.
This is a relationship-development position for someone who thrives in a role which combines networking with disciplined follow-up, CRM management, event planning, intake coordination and measurable pipeline accountability.
The successful candidate will build relationships on behalf of the firm, not as a personal book of business. Qualified contacts will be introduced to the CEO and other firm leaders so trust, knowledge and follow-up are shared across the organization.
Requirements
· Three or more years of successful experience in law-firm business development, legal marketing, community outreach, professional-services sales, healthcare liaison work, territory development or a related relationship-driven role.
· Demonstrated ability to build professional relationships from first contact through executive introduction and measurable conversion.
· Strong in-person communication, professional writing, follow-up and organizational skills.
· Working knowledge of CRM systems and comfort being held accountable to documented activity and outcome metrics.
· Ability to work independently in the field while communicating closely with the CEO, intake, marketing and operations teams.
· Valid driver's license, reliable transportation and ability to travel frequently throughout California.
· Availability for regular lunches, evening networking, weekend events and periodic overnight or out-of-state travel.
· Ability to transport, set up and break down event materials weighing up to approximately 35 pounds, with or without reasonable accommodation.
Strongly Preferred
· Professional fluency in English and Spanish.
· Existing familiarity with Plaintiff-side Personal Injury, attorney referral networks, healthcare or rehabilitation providers, the auto and transportation ecosystem, agricultural communities or California community organizations.
· Experience attending or supporting bar association, trial-lawyer, trade-show or nationwide legal events.
Experience creating territory plans, event ROI reports, referral-source pipelines or executive-level introductions
